How to Install and Uninstall leechcraft-cstp Package on openSuSE Tumbleweed
Last updated: February 02,2025
1. Install "leechcraft-cstp" package
In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to install leechcraft-cstp on openSuSE Tumbleweed
$
sudo zypper refresh
Copied
$
sudo zypper install
leechcraft-cstp
Copied
2. Uninstall "leechcraft-cstp" package
In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to uninstall leechcraft-cstp on openSuSE Tumbleweed:
$
sudo zypper remove
leechcraft-cstp

3. Information about the leechcraft-cstp package on openSuSE Tumbleweed
Information for package leechcraft-cstp:
----------------------------------------
Repository : openSUSE-Tumbleweed-Oss
Name : leechcraft-cstp
Version : 0.6.70+git.14794.g33744ae6ce-3.8
Arch : x86_64
Vendor : openSUSE
Installed Size : 242.4 KiB
Installed : No
Status : not installed
Source package : leechcraft-0.6.70+git.14794.g33744ae6ce-3.8.src
Upstream URL : https://leechcraft.org
Summary : LeechCraft HTTP Module
Description :
This package provides a HTTP implementation plugin for LeechCraft
which will mainly used by many other plugins like Aggregator or
SeekThru.
Features:
* Support for redirects.
* Automatic downloads from other plugins.
* Support for continuing interrupted downloads.
